Ubuntu忘记root密码?掌握安全有效的重置方法
在Ubuntu系统中,root账户是一个非常特殊且重要的存在。简单来说,root账户就像是系统的“管理员”,拥有对系统所有文件和程序的完全访问权限。这个账户可以进行任何操作,包括安装和配置软件、修改系统设置等。因此,对root账户的管理尤为重要。如果他人获得了root权限,系统的安全性将大大降低,这意味着用户需要非常小心,确保root密码的保密和安全。
转眼之间,我们可能会遇到与root账户相关的一些常见问题,比如忘记root密码。在日常使用中,很多用户可能并不频繁登陆root账户,而在偶尔需要使用它的时候,往往会遇到这种尴尬的境地。此时,如果密码被遗忘,就可能导致无法进行系统管理工作,影响系统的正常使用。那么,如何有效地管理和保护root账户呢?
有时,我们可能会面临重置root密码的必要情境。例如,当新用户接手系统管理工作时,确保拥有正确的root密码是非常重要的。这可以避免未来因为权限不当而导致的安全风险。此外,服务器或特定的应用场景中,由于技术更新或维护,可能会更换管理员,这也需要重置密码,以确保权限的完整性。在这些情况下,理解如何安全和有效地重置root密码,就显得极为关键。因此,掌握重置root密码的方法,将为Ubuntu用户提供更多便利和保障。
在遇到忘记root密码的情况时,我们需要掌握几种有效的重置方法。整个过程可能让人感觉有些繁琐,但只要按照步骤操作,通常都能顺利解决问题。接下来我将分享几种常见的方法。
首先,通过安全模式重置密码是一种直接且有效的方式。开启电脑时,按下Shift键可以进入GRUB菜单。看到菜单后,选择一种恢复模式,通常是带有“(recovery mode)”字样的选项。进入安全模式后,你会看到一系列选项,其中包括一个叫做“root”的选项。选择它后,系统会以超级用户权限启动。在这里,你将能使用“passwd”命令来修改root密码。整个过程简单明了,也无需额外的工具。
另一个常用的方法是使用Live CD或USB重置密码。准备一个启动的Live CD或USB,插入电脑后重新启动。在启动选项中选择该设备进入Live环境。进入后,我们需要找到系统安装的分区进行挂载。通常情况下,分区名为/dev/sda1等等。挂载后,可以使用chroot命令切换到该分区的环境中。这样,你就能够直接使用“passwd”命令对root账户进行密码重置,这种方法适用于无法进入原系统的情况。
对于更进阶的用户,还有一些其他工具和命令可以帮助重置密码。例如,利用chroot命令,可以在Live环境中切换到根文件系统,从而更便捷地管理系统。而rescue模式也提供了类似的功能,可以在特定情况下帮助用户进行密码重置。
掌握这些方法后,无论何时忘记root密码,我们都能从容应对。系统的管理与维护变得更加顺畅,增加了用户查询和解决问题的能力。希望这些方法对你在Ubuntu使用中有所帮助。